We have a few things going against us Mick'.

We are Celtic, as such we demand that we not only win a game but look damn good doing it. That kind of pressure, week in, week out, places fantastic demands on the manager who's job is on the line. Does he want to blood youth?

Celtic have the capacity to buy first team ready players from other clubs, so trying to shift them as a youth player is a huge ask at times. Being the top team in Scotland means you have to be an exceptional talent these days (CalMac, Tierney as mentioned) or play in an era where the board have no ambition or are just plain tight! Ralston is a good example of right time right place.

Our youth program has produced a few crackers and a few that have hit the bar like Christie and MJ. We have also let great talent go by not recognising their potential like Robertson at Liverpool.

The talent is there - they just can't get the game time needed to prove themselves or a manager too afraid of the "Spanish Archer".

Solutions? Thinking out the box. Apart from the obvious how about we buy a diddy team in The League of Ireland (or wherever) and loan most of our known talent to that club so they get competitive football in a competitive league every week? They are not getting that in Scotland but I can gaurantee they will develope better and faster. Other options are available!
